What is Idarubicin Hydrochloride?

Zavedos (Idarubicin Hydrochloride) is a chemotherapy medication used to treat certain cancers. It belongs to the anthracycline class and works by slowing or stopping cancer cell growth. This prescription-only drug is administered intravenously under medical supervision. Always consult a healthcare provider for proper use.

What is Idarubicin Hydrochloride used for?

Zavedos is primarily used in cancer treatment, including acute myeloid leukemia and other malignancies. It may be prescribed when other therapies are ineffective or as part of a combination regimen. What are the side effects of Idarubicin Hydrochloride?

As a chemotherapy agent, Zavedos affects rapidly dividing cells, which can include both cancerous and healthy cells. Common effects may include temporary changes in blood cell counts, nausea, or fatigue. Hair loss is a known possibility due to its impact on cell turnover. These effects vary by patient and treatment duration.

What precautions apply to Idarubicin Hydrochloride?

Zavedos should only be handled and administered by trained healthcare professionals due to its potency. Patients must disclose full medical history, especially heart conditions or prior chemotherapy. Regular monitoring of heart function and blood counts is typically required during treatment. Avoid exposure to infections and maintain hydration as directed.

What does Idarubicin Hydrochloride interact with?

Zavedos may interact with other medications, including certain antibiotics, blood thinners, or heart medications. Strong CYP3A4 inhibitors can increase Idarubicin levels, while inducers may reduce effectiveness. Alcohol and live vaccines should be avoided during treatment. Always inform healthcare providers about all medications and supplements being taken.
